Futaba Clinic is an internal medicine clinic located in Futaba, Shinagawa Ward, Tokyo, with convenient access from Nishi-Oi Station to meet the medical needs of the local community. In addition to internal medicine, the clinic provides cardiology and rehabilitation services, with Dr. Mikihiko Kameyama, a Doctor of Medicine and clinic director, drawing on his experience from the First Department of Internal Medicine at Nippon Medical School. After graduating from Nippon Medical School, he specialized in general internal medicine and cardiology at the university and also worked in the cardiology department of Inada Masuko Hospital of the National Mutual Insurance Federation, bringing specialized knowledge and technical expertise. The clinic aims to provide warm, detailed care in a home-like atmosphere, serving as a trusted primary care physician for the community. English-speaking staff are available, and the facility features parking and barrier-free access to accommodate diverse patients. The clinic is closed on Sundays, holidays, and during the New Year period. Influenza vaccinations are available on a walk-in basis without reservations. Wait times tend to be longer during cold and flu season, particularly on weekday and Saturday mornings. The clinic supports eligibility verification using My Number cards, allowing patients to access their medication records and specific health checkup information.
